Let us dig in. adobe Premiere Pro CC is a powerful timeline-based video editing application. Using Premiere Pro, you can edit video and audio clips into sequences, apply effects and transitions, export your sequences for sharing with others, and more.

What settings does Premiere Pro use to render my sequence?
From this window, you select the settings Premiere Pro will use to render your sequence., and a. Format– Select H.264, the recommended format for uploading video to the web (See Figure 58)., and b. Preset – If you have a specific destination in mind, select it. In this example, we are selecting High Quality 1080p HD(See Figure 58)., and c.
